Mandatory Modules
1. Technopreneurship (F/617/6740): 20 UK Credits/ 10 ECTS Credits.
- Explore the principles of entrepreneurship in technology-driven industries.
- Develop innovative solutions to meet market demands using IT tools.
2. Network Security (J/617/6741): 20 UK Credits/ 10 ECTS Credits.
- Understand the principles of securing networks and protecting sensitive information.
- Implement measures to mitigate cyber threats and safeguard IT systems.
3. C#.NET Programming (L/617/6742): 20 UK Credits/ 10 ECTS Credits.
- Learn programming with C#.NET for software and network applications.
- Apply programming concepts to develop secure and efficient IT solutions.
4. System Administration (R/617/6743): 20 UK Credits/ 10 ECTS Credits.
- Master system operations, including installation, configuration, and maintenance.
- Troubleshoot and optimize system performance to ensure efficiency.
5. Network Routing and Switching (Y/617/6744): 20 UK Credits/ 10 ECTS Credits.
- Learn the fundamentals of routing and switching in network environments.
- Design, implement, and manage network systems for seamless connectivity.
6. Network Design and Administration (D/617/6745): 20 UK Credits/ 10 ECTS Credits.
- Understand the process of designing scalable and secure network infrastructures.
- Develop advanced administrative skills to monitor and optimize network performance.
Assignments
- Complete 6 written assignments (2,000–3,000 words each) based on the module titles.
